溫馨提示×

plsql怎么查詢顯示注釋

小億
432
2023-10-27 13:17:10
欄目: 云計算

在PL/SQL中,要查詢顯示注釋,可以使用以下方法:

  1. 使用DBMS_METADATA.GET_DDL函數(shù)查詢表的注釋:
DECLARE
  v_ddl CLOB;
BEGIN
  v_ddl := DBMS_METADATA.GET_DDL('TABLE', 'YOUR_TABLE_NAME');
  DBMS_OUTPUT.PUT_LINE(v_ddl);
END;
/

將上述代碼中的YOUR_TABLE_NAME替換為你要查詢的表名。

  1. 使用USER_TAB_COMMENTS數(shù)據(jù)字典視圖查詢表的注釋:
SELECT comments
FROM user_tab_comments
WHERE table_name = 'YOUR_TABLE_NAME';

將上述代碼中的YOUR_TABLE_NAME替換為你要查詢的表名。

  1. 使用DBMS_OUTPUT.PUT_LINE函數(shù)直接輸出注釋:
DECLARE
  v_comments VARCHAR2(4000);
BEGIN
  SELECT comments INTO v_comments
  FROM user_tab_comments
  WHERE table_name = 'YOUR_TABLE_NAME';

  DBMS_OUTPUT.PUT_LINE(v_comments);
END;
/

將上述代碼中的YOUR_TABLE_NAME替換為你要查詢的表名。

注意:以上方法只適用于表的注釋查詢,如果要查詢其他對象(如函數(shù)、存儲過程、觸發(fā)器等)的注釋,需要使用相應(yīng)的數(shù)據(jù)字典視圖或系統(tǒng)函數(shù)。

0